Just wondered if anyone has any of these recordings?  There were released on Melodiya, but almost impossible to find.

Thanks
Dave

BARABASHOV, V.      Adagio for Symphony Orch (URSO)   SM3943/4
DANKEVICH, K.      Taras Shev-Poem/Lileya ballet suite      D-6749      http://orpheusandlyra.tripod.com/ukrainian_balett/id1.html
DREMLYUGA              In Memory of Hero, sym poem      D-11731
KLEBANOV              Aistenok – suite from ballet      D-11713
RYBALCHENKO      Joyful Overture         D-25875
RYBALCHENKO      Suite No 2            D-11731
YAROVINSKY, B.      Symphony No 2 (URSO)      D-11677/8
ZADOR         The Carpathians, Cantata      D-22315
